Pakistan near the Afghan Border is the gateway to Central Asia and the Himalayas. The thick forests offered a historically rare source of hardwood in Asia and as result of this a legacy of cultural carving developed. Utilitarian objects were all carved form wood as were buildings, doors and furniture. This unique antique low table was used by the side of a low chair to hold tea, food and books.
